Sainz can't see himself beating Leclerc: 'It's going to be hard'

On Friday Ferrari gave its first presentation. The video was all about introducing the new team. Charles Leclerc, Carlos Sainz and team boss Mattia Binotto asked each other questions. One of the topics was the role of Sainz. Leclerc asked his new teammate if he saw himself beating Leclerc. After some chuckling, the Spaniard answered honestly. "For me, this year will be a bit complicated to beat you. Because I don't know the team and the car, but I will do my best. If there is a year where we have to work together, I think it will be this year." Rebuilding Ferrari By this Sainz is referring to the expectations of the Italians this year.
